Annapurna Sanctuary Trekking

The Annapurna Sanctuary / Base camp trek is a hike into the dazzling natural amphitheater formed by the staggeringly beautiful peaks of the giants Annapurna 1, Glacier Dome, Gangapurna, Fang and the fishtail peak of Machapuchare. Although there is only one entrance to the sanctuary itself, we follow lesser-used approach and exit routes.

Annapurna Sanctuary Trekking

The vast amphitheater of the Annapurna Sanctuary is encircled by the famous Himalayan peaks – the 'fishtail' spire of Machapuchare (6997m), Gangapurna (7454m) Annapurna 1 (8091m), unclimbed Fang (7647m) and Annapurna South (7273m). The only approach follows the Modi Khola Valley through forests of Oak, Rhododendron and Bamboo, passing Annapurna Sanctuary Trekkingthrough and beyond Gurung villages to a world of soaring peaks.

The flight from Kathmandu to Pokhara takes us pass 3 8000m giants . We start our trek with a short drive from Pokhara to Nayapul. We walk to a village by the Modi River, Birethanti(1000m). Walking through oak forest we cross several side valleys, which run into the Modi Khola, and climb a stone 'staircase' to the Gurung village of Chomrong (2060m). Trekking past Hinku cave, we reach what is known as the 'gate' into the Sanctuary – a pass between the spectacular peaks of Hiunchuli and Machapuchare.

The glaciated and snow covered peaks of the Sanctuary form a spectacular barrier. Dazzling views confront us as we trek up through the last permanent settlements to the Machapuchare Base Camp (3729m) where we are rewarded with superb views of 'Fishtail' mountain. While here we will also visit the Annapurna South Base camp.

Day to Day Itinerary (16 days)
Day   Activities
Day 1 - KATHMANDU Arrive and transfer to hotel. Later this evening you will have the chance to meet your Trek Leader and the other members of the tour.
Day 2 - KATHMANDU Morning walking tour of the market area of Ason, Durbar Square and Swayambunath Temple.
Day 3 - BIRETHANTI (1,000m) Fly from Kathmandu to Pokhara and drive the pleasant riverside village of Birethanti, at the edge of the Annapurna trekking region.
Day 4 - BANTHANTI (2,300m) Our first day on the trail, we trek through oak and rhododendron forests and follow the Bhurungdi Khola (river) to Banthanti.
Day 5 - GHOREPANI (2,850m) We continue along the Bhurungdi Khola and ascend Ulleri Hill, eventually arriving at Ghorepani where there are perfect views of the Annapurna range.
Day 6 - POON HILL - TADAPANI Rise early to climb up Poon Hill to watch a magnificent sunrise over the Himalaya. From west to east you can see Dhaulagiri, Tukuche, Dhampus Peak, Nilgiri, Annapurnas and Machapuchare - breathtaking! We then continue to Tadapani, trekking through open grassland and deep forests. On the way there are excellent views of Annapurna South and the Manaslu range.
Day 7 - CHOMRONG (2,000m) Today, we have a steep descent through rhododendron forest to the valley bottom, with fabulous mountain views. Later the path climbs steeply again before we arrive at the lively trekking hub of Chomrong.
Day 8 - DOBAN (2,500m) Our trail descends on a stone staircase and crosses the Chomrong Khola before climbing through deep rhododendron and bamboo forests to Doban.
Day 9 - MACHAPUCHARE BASE CAMP (3,600m) The goal today is to pass through the gates of the sanctuary. We trek up the muddy surface of the Modi Khola, then along a rocky trail to Hinku cave.
From here we climb towards the base camp of Machapuchare. There are stupendous views of the Hiunchuli, Annapurna I & III, Gangapurna and Machapuchare, the 'fish tail' mountain peak.
Day 10 - ANNAPURNA BASE CAMP (4,100m) We continue our exploration of the sanctuary and ascend to the Annapurna Base Camp.
Day 11 - BAMBOO (2,500m) Retracing our steps we return along the only route to Bamboo.
Day 12 - JHINU (1,750m) Descend to Chomrong, continue to Jhinu hot spring where we can enjoy a hot spring bath and soothe our trekking muscles!
Day 13 - POTANA (1,600m) Our last full day trekking, we follow the route to the village of Pothana.
Day 14 - PHEDI - POKHARA A short morning trek to pick up our vehicle for the journey to Pokhara.
Rest of the day at leisure in this beautiful lakeside city.
Day 15 - KATHMANDU Drive to Kathmandu.
Day 16 - KATHMANDU Tour ends. International Departure
